Position Overview

Hays CISD is seeking a Director of Construction and Planning to coordinate and oversee all district construction and renovation projects from concept through completion. This leadership role is responsible for long-range facilities planning, land planning and development, demographic analysis, and ensuring compliance with planning, zoning, and regulatory requirements.

The Director works closely with architects, engineers, contractors, and district leadership to ensure that school facilities support instructional goals while meeting safety, budgetary, and regulatory standards.

Key Responsibilities
  • Oversee new construction, renovations, and facility improvements across the district.
  • Serve as liaison to architects, engineers, and consultants to develop, review, and finalize project plans, drawings, and specifications.
  • Coordinate and conduct project development meetings and monitor construction progress schedules.
  • Conduct on-site inspections to ensure projects align with construction documents and district needs.
  • Work with city, county, state, and federal officials to ensure compliance with building codes, zoning ordinances, and regulatory requirements.
  • Maintain district roofing and HVAC replacement cycles and recommend facility improvements.
Planning and Design Collaboration
  • Collaborate with faculty, administrators, and community stakeholders to determine program-driven design needs.
  • Participate in architect, engineer, and contractor prequalification processes.
  • Ensure smooth transition of facilities from contractors to district operations upon completion.
Budget and Contract Management
  • Estimate costs for construction and repair projects including labor, materials, and related expenses.
  • Assist in preparing bid documents and evaluating contractor proposals.
  • Review and authorize contractor payment requests and ensure contractual obligations are met prior to final payment.
  • Ensure projects remain cost-effective and funds are managed responsibly.
Safety and Compliance
  • Maintain safety standards in accordance with federal, state, and insurance regulations.
  • Ensure district construction projects comply with applicable safety, health, and regulatory requirements.
Qualifications Experience
  • Minimum of five years of experience in construction, maintenance, or a related field.
  • Three years of supervisory experience in construction, facilities, or maintenance management.
Knowledge & Skills
  • Knowledge of project planning and construction principles.
  • Familiarity with mechanical and electrical design and installation.
  • Understanding of building codes, zoning ordinances, and inspection processes.
  • Ability to read blueprints and schematics.
  • Str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ills.
